Argentina’s Business Process Outsourcing (BPO) market has rapidly evolved into one of the most competitive in Latin America, leveraging the country’s highly educated workforce, strong digital infrastructure, and proximity to major international markets, particularly in North America and Europe. Argentina’s unique value proposition lies in its bilingual (Spanish and English) capabilities, which make it an attractive nearshore outsourcing destination for U.S. and European companies seeking high-quality, cost-effective solutions. The country’s labor force is well-versed in various industries, including finance, healthcare, technology, telecommunications, and customer service, and it is increasingly skilled in emerging areas such as data analytics, artificial intelligence (AI), and robotic process automation (RPA). Argentina’s education system produces a steady stream of university graduates and technical professionals, particularly in STEM fields, contributing to a talent pool that can meet the growing demand for complex BPO services. This talent pool, combined with Argentina’s reputation for creativity and problem-solving, has allowed the country to diversify its BPO offerings beyond traditional customer support and back-office services to include more specialized services like IT support, software development, and digital marketing. Additionally, Argentina’s favorable time zone (which aligns with North American business hours) and the country’s established communication infrastructure allow for seamless interactions with international clients, contributing to its growing appeal as a nearshore outsourcing hub. Government support, such as tax incentives and initiatives aimed at fostering innovation, has further bolstered the BPO industry.
According to the research report "Argentina Business Process Outsourcing Market Overview, 2030," published by Bonafide Research, the Argentina Business Process Outsourcing market was valued at more than USD 2.03 Billion in 2024. The country’s political and economic stability, along with its commitment to fostering a business-friendly environment, has helped Argentina carve out a niche in the global BPO market. While the country has faced economic challenges, such as inflation and fluctuating currency values, the BPO sector has remained resilient, with businesses increasingly turning to outsourcing to manage costs and improve operational efficiency. Argentine BPO companies are increasingly adopting cutting-edge technologies to enhance their service offerings, with automation tools and AI solutions becoming standard components of many service delivery models. For instance, companies in sectors like banking and finance are increasingly outsourcing back-office functions such as fraud detection, transaction processing, and regulatory compliance to BPO providers that can integrate these services with advanced technology platforms. In addition, the country’s well-established telecommunications infrastructure and strong internet connectivity enable companies to provide consistent, high-quality services, making Argentina an attractive destination for IT outsourcing and cloud-based services. The demand for customer service outsourcing in Argentina continues to grow, particularly for industries like retail, telecommunications, and travel, as more companies look for multilingual customer support that aligns with the global demand for personalized service. Furthermore, as Argentina increasingly positions itself as a hub for knowledge-intensive BPO services, there is a growing focus on industry-specific expertise, with providers specializing in sectors such as healthcare, legal process outsourcing, and e-commerce. Argentina’s strong track record in customer relationship management (CRM) and digital marketing also makes it a popular choice for companies seeking to enhance their customer engagement strategies.

Finance & Accounting outsourcing in Argentina is steadily growing, driven by businesses seeking to reduce overhead and improve compliance with local and international financial standards. Services such as bookkeeping, tax preparation, payroll, and financial reporting are commonly outsourced, with local providers increasingly incorporating cloud accounting platforms and automation tools to enhance accuracy and timeliness. Customer Support is one of the most mature segments in the country’s BPO landscape, particularly for companies from North America and Europe that benefit from Argentina’s neutral Spanish accent and time zone compatibility. Argentine BPO firms offer omnichannel support via voice, email, chat, and social media across various industries including telecom, retail, and banking. Human Resources outsourcing is also gaining traction as companies seek support for talent acquisition, training, performance tracking, and benefits administration. The country's educated workforce and increasing familiarity with international labor standards make it an appealing HR outsourcing destination. IT Services form a critical part of Argentina’s BPO offering, supported by a strong base of software developers, system analysts, and cybersecurity experts. Services such as application development, tech support, software maintenance, and IT infrastructure management are widely provided, contributing to Argentina’s growing reputation as a nearshore tech hub. Procurement & Supply Chain functions, including vendor management, order processing, and logistics support, are gradually being outsourced to improve operational flexibility. The others category includes marketing, sales support, and legal services, with companies leveraging Argentina’s bilingual capabilities and relatively low labor costs for high-value knowledge process outsourcing.
The IT & Telecommunications industry relies heavily on outsourced services including customer support, network monitoring, and technical troubleshooting, benefiting from Argentina’s skilled IT professionals and reliable digital infrastructure. With the country becoming a regional hub for software development, BPO providers are offering increasingly advanced solutions tailored to the needs of telecom operators and tech firms. In the BFSI sector, banks and insurance companies outsource operations like document processing, fraud prevention, customer support, and regulatory compliance management. These services help firms meet stringent security standards while controlling costs in a dynamic regulatory environment. The Manufacturing sector utilizes BPO for supply chain optimization, procurement management, and quality assurance documentation, especially as Argentine industries expand their global footprints. Retailers, particularly e-commerce platforms, are outsourcing customer engagement, payment processing, inventory tracking, and returns management to ensure timely service and efficient operations. Healthcare, although a relatively smaller segment, is growing as medical institutions and health insurers outsource claims processing, appointment scheduling, and patient data management. Privacy and compliance with healthcare regulations are critical, prompting BPO providers to adopt robust data protection protocols. Other industries, including tourism, logistics, and education, are increasingly turning to BPO for functions like helpdesk support, content moderation, and administrative processing. Argentina’s diverse industrial base, combined with its educated, bilingual workforce and cultural compatibility with Western markets, enhances the attractiveness of its BPO services across sectors.
Front Office BPO includes all customer-facing operations such as customer service, technical support, telemarketing, and sales assistance. With its time zone alignment to the U.S. and Europe and a large number of professionals fluent in English and Spanish, Argentina has become a nearshore destination for customer engagement services. Companies in sectors like telecom, finance, and online retail frequently outsource front office operations to Argentine providers, who in turn are embracing AI tools, CRM platforms, and chatbot technologies to enhance service quality and responsiveness. The emphasis on high-quality, culturally aware customer interaction makes Argentina especially attractive for businesses seeking personalized and localized support. In contrast, Back Office BPO encompasses internal functions such as data entry, finance and accounting, HR processing, procurement administration, and IT support. Argentine BPO providers offer efficient, cost-effective solutions for these non-core functions, helping businesses improve productivity and reduce costs. With growing expertise in automation and cloud-based platforms, Argentina’s back office outsourcing has evolved to include advanced services like data analytics, digital document management, and compliance monitoring. These capabilities are particularly beneficial for SMEs and multinationals looking to optimize their internal operations without expanding their in-house teams. Many Argentine BPO providers now offer hybrid models, combining both front and back-office services into integrated solutions to deliver greater efficiency and strategic value. Additionally, a strong educational system and tech talent pipeline continue to support the country's capability to deliver high-end BPO services.
